4 What is Color? Color- An art element with three properties; hue, value, and intensity. Also, the character of surfaces created by the response of vision to wavelengths of reflected light.

5 The Source of Color When a ray of white light passes through a glass prism, the ray is bent, or refracted. This ray of light them separates into individual bands of color, called the COLOR SPECTRUM.

7 Pigment The powdered coloring material used in making artist’s media (paints, crayons, inks, etc.) are called PIGMENTS. Can be natural or chemical (man-made) Never quite as pure as the color spectrum Pigments used in Dyes in India

9 Neutral Colors Not all objects have colors that are in the spectrum.
We do not clearly see any one color in them. They are not associated with hue. White The sum of all colors – a white object REFLECTS to our eyes all the wavelengths shining on it, absorbing none of them. Black The total absence of reflected light; it results when an object ABSORBS all the wavelengths shining on it, reflecting none of them. Gray Created by PARTIAL REFLECTION (mixed black + white)

10 The Properties of Color
There are three properties that can be defined and measured: HUE VALUE INTENSITY

11 Hue HUE-The property of color that distinguishes one gradiation from another and gives it its name. Examples of Hue: “blue”, “red”, “green” Each hue has a different wavelength Blue is 19 millionths of an inch long Red is 30 millionths of an inch long Refers to the color’s position on the spectrum.

12 The Color Wheel A simplified version of the color spectrum, bent into a circle An important tool for the artist – arranges it for easy study

13 The Color Wheel Made of three types of colors: Primary Secondary
Intermediate/ Tertiary

14 Primary Colors The three basic colors from which it is possible to mix all other colors. The primaries cannot be produced by mixing pigments. Red, Yellow, and Blue

15 Secondary Colors Secondary Colors- Colors that result from the mixture of two primary colors. Orange Green Violet

16 Intermediate/Tertiary Colors
Intermediate colors- Colors produced by mixing a primary color and the adjacent secondary color on the color wheel. Also made by mixing unequal amounts of two primaries. Also called “Tertiary Colors” Yellow-green Red-violet Blue-green Red-orange Blue-violet Yellow-orange

21 Complementary Colors

22 Complementary Colors They appear opposite each other on a color wheel.
One of the most important color relationships illustrated in the color wheel. They appear opposite each other on a color wheel. Three main sets: Yellow and Violet Green and Red Blue and Orange What other sets can we identify?

23 Complementary Colors They show a maximum visual contrast between colors. The line where two complementary colors meet seems to vibrate in a composition.

25 Pointillism & Optical Fusion
(Left) Circus Parade by George Seurat (detail below) Pointillism & Optical Fusion Pointillism is a technique that relies on something called optical fusion /optical mixing where our eyes blend colors that are separated on the paper. Pointillism uses thousands of small dots of color, building up thousands of points for the viewer’s eyes to blend.

31 How can value affect color?
Value is an aspect of all colors! Every color has a normal value, which is shown on the color wheel. Example: Red The value of the color can be changed by adding white or black to the color. Example: Red with black added Red with white added

32 Tints of a Color Adding white to a hue produces a TINT.
A tint is lighter in value. Tint = Hue + White

33 Hue + White = Tint Primaries + = Secondaries + =

34 Shades of a Color Adding BLACK to a color produces a SHADE.
A shade is darker in value. Shade = Hue + Black

35 Hue + Black = Shade Primaries + = Secondaries + =

36 So Many Colors! There are no limitations of value in color.
Tints and shades can be made of any color: primary, secondary, intermediate, and anywhere in between.

37 SO Many Colors! There may be as many value steps between the lightest and darkest appearance of a color as there are between black and white.

43 INTENSITY: A Property of Color

44 Properties of Color Hue identifies color as blue, green, red, yellow, etc. as seen in the spectrum of the color wheel Value: refers to the darkness or lightness or a color INTENSITY: ???

45 Intensity Intensity refers to the quality of light in a color. It is different from value (which refers to the quantity of light that a color reflects) example: light/dark colors of the hue Intensity refers to the BRIGHTER and DULLER colors of the same hue. Also known as saturation or strength.

46 Changing Intensity Create a TONE – or mix the color with grey.
A color, as it appears on the value scale, is at its’ brightest. Two ways to change intensity: Create a TONE – or mix the color with grey. Mix the color with its’ complement.

47 Hue + Grey = TONE Any hue mixed with grey is called a TONE.

48 Mixing Complements When mixing complementary colors, bit by bit, a neutral gray is formed. This is because the complementary colors represent an equal balance of the three primary hues. What are our complementary colors?

51 Color Schemes / Color Harmonies
When artists & designers use combinations of colors to get certain results, they are using color schemes or color harmonies. Color Harmony/Color Scheme – Combinations of color that can be defined by their positions on the color wheel. Particular color harmonies may be used to achieve specific effects. A PLAN FOR ORGANIZING COLORS!

52 Color Schemes – plans for organizing colors
Analogous Complementary Split-Complementary Triad Monochromatic Warm Colors Cool Colors

53 Analogous Colors Analogous colors are next to each other or adjacent on the color wheel. They have a single color in common. Because of this common color, they naturally relate well to each other.

54 Analogous Colors Honore Fragonard used analogous colors in A Young Girl Reading. The color group is yellow, yellow-orange, and orange. These analogous colors give a warm and soothing quality to the work. Where have you seen clothing like this? When and where do you think this painting was made?

60 Split-Complementary This is made up of a color plus the two hues on either side of that color’s complement. Such a combination forms sharp contrast within a design.

63 Triad A triadic harmony involves three equally spaced hues on the color wheel. (equidistant) What other sets of triads can you see?

64 Triad What triadic colors did William de Kooning use in his painting? Triads are very tense b/c they are mutually dissimilar.

65 Monochromatic A color scheme using only one hue, plus black and white.

66 Monochromatic Contrast is created by the use of lights and darks (value contrast). Because only one hue is used, all the parts of a monochromatic design work well together.

69 Warm and Cool Colors When the color wheel is divided in half, a line separates the warm from the cool. Using warm and cool can result in a very expressive effect because of our associations with colors.

70 Warm Colors Warm colors are the hues that range from yellow to red-violet. They are associated with warm objects or circumstances.

73 Cool Colors The cool colors are the hues that range from yellow-green to violet. They are associated with coldness or coolness.

77 Effects of Warm & Cool Colors
Warm colors advance or come towards us in a design. Cool colors seem to recede or go backward in a design.

78 Effects of Warm/Cool Colors
Warm Colors make shapes and forms appear larger. Cool Colors make shapes and forms appear smaller.
